Synology-Forum.nl
Tweaks / Addons A.K.A. The Underground => Algemeen => Topic gestart door: cogmios op 02 mei 2008, 00:17:39
-
Hallo, ik heb:
- in mijn /volume1/photo al mijn foto's en diverse .mov's
- de folders zijn onderverdeeld in jaren en daarbinnen hebben ze namen als "/2002-03-21 Feestje bij Jan" enz...
- omdat ik ook o.a. picasa en irfanview gebruik vanaf andere werkplekken staan er ook bestanden/dirs in als /.piccache en /Originals e.d.
Ik heb nu bij mijn webhost een zenphoto album aangemaakt enerzijds om alles via het web te benaderen en anderzijds om daar nog een veilige copie te hebben. Zodra
je foto albums plaatst in een folder in de album dir van zenphoto verschijnen de fotos automatisch in het webalbum
Ik wil nu automatisch synchronizeren tussen mijn webhost en mijn DS maar (dus) op basis van ftp.
Ik heb lftp ge-IPKGD en heb het volgende ASH scriptje gemaakt:
#!/bin/ash
SOURCE=/volume1/photo
BACKUPDIR=/domains/test.com/html/gallery/albums
lftp -u serveradmin@test.com,WACHTWOORD ftp.9999.gridserver.com << EOF
mirror -R -n -I *.jpg -I *.JPG -X @eaDir/ -X Collage/ -X 'Vanalles/' -X .piccache/ -X .recent/ -X Originals/ -X *.Db $SOURCE/ $BACKUPDIR/
quit
Voor dat je dit CRONt:
a) Draai hem eerst een paar keer vanaf een terminal window.
- Als je bepaalde foto's hebt die elke keer weer worden geupload dan hebben ze een verkeerde datum e.g. "00-01-06" of "01-06-12" o.i.d.
- Ik had 1 directory waar hij op bleef hangen, na renamen van deze directory liep hij gewoon door
- als je eerst CD-t naar de source directory en dan de $SOURCE/ vervangt in de mirror regel dan neemt hij de inhoud van de directory dus neemt hij niet de directory "photo" mee
- als je meerdere jaren op schijf hebt staan kun je het beste meerdere scripts maken per jaar. Omdat waarschijnlijk de meeste mutaties binnen het laatste jaar plaatsvinden.
b) Draai hem na enige tijd weer eens om te checken of hij niet blijft hangen bij een van de nieuwe directories die je hebt gecreeerd.